首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ux下安装git客户端

在Linux系统下安装Git客户端是一个相对简单的过程。Git是一个分布式版本控制系统,广泛用于软件开发中,以跟踪文件的更改和管理项目的版本历史。

基础概念

Git是一个版本控制系统,它允许开发者记录每次代码的更改,回溯到历史版本,以及协同工作。Git的核心概念包括仓库(repository)、提交(commit)、分支(branch)和合并(merge)。

安装步骤

对于基于Debian的系统(如Ubuntu)

  1. 打开终端。
  2. 更新软件包列表:
  3. 更新软件包列表:
  4. 安装Git:
  5. 安装Git:

对于基于Red Hat的系统(如CentOS)

  1. 打开终端。
  2. 安装EPEL仓库(如果尚未安装):
  3. 安装EPEL仓库(如果尚未安装):
  4. 安装Git:
  5. 安装Git:

验证安装

安装完成后,可以通过以下命令验证Git是否正确安装:

代码语言:txt
复制
git --version

这将显示安装的Git版本号。

优势

  • 分布式版本控制:每个开发者都有完整的仓库副本。
  • 高效的数据传输:通过压缩和差异算法减少数据传输量。
  • 强大的分支管理:轻松创建和管理多个开发分支。
  • 灵活的工作流程:支持多种工作流程,如功能分支、Gitflow等。

应用场景

  • 软件开发:跟踪代码变更,协作开发。
  • 文档管理:版本控制和多人编辑文档。
  • 数据科学:管理实验数据和代码。

常见问题及解决方法

问题:权限问题

如果在安装过程中遇到权限问题,确保使用sudo命令提升权限。

问题:依赖问题

如果在安装过程中遇到依赖问题,尝试更新软件包管理器或手动安装缺失的依赖。

问题:版本过旧

如果安装的Git版本过旧,可以尝试添加新的软件源或使用包管理器的升级命令。

示例代码

以下是一个简单的Git使用示例:

代码语言:txt
复制
# 初始化一个新的Git仓库
git init

# 添加文件到仓库
git add .

# 提交更改
git commit -m "Initial commit"

# 创建一个新的分支
git branch new-feature

# 切换到新分支
git checkout new-feature

# 在新分支上进行更改并提交
git add .
git commit -m "Added new feature"

# 切换回主分支
git checkout master

# 合并新分支到主分支
git merge new-feature

通过以上步骤,你可以在Linux系统下成功安装并开始使用Git客户端。如果在安装或使用过程中遇到具体问题,可以根据错误信息进行相应的排查和解决。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

初始Git及Linux Centos下安装Git

版本控制系统可以告诉你每次的改动,⽐如在第5⾏加了⼀个单词“Linux”,在第8⾏删了⼀个单“Windows” ⽽图⽚、视频这些⼆进制⽂件,虽然也能由版本控制系统管理,但没法跟踪⽂件的变化,只能把⼆进制...⽂件每次改动串起来,也就是只知道图⽚从100KB改成了120KB,但到底改了啥,版本控制系统不知道,也没法知道 Git安装 Git是开放源代码的代码托管⼯具,最早是在Linux下开发的。...开始也只能应⽤于Linux平台,后⾯慢慢的被移植到windows下,现在,Git可以在Linux、Unix、Mac和Windows这⼏⼤平台上正常运⾏了。...如果你的的平台是centos,安装git相当简单,小编以Linux-centos为例安装。...首先你可以先试试自己的平台有没有安装git 如果是这个页面,则说明你的平台上已经有git 如果没有安装,使用如下指令: sudo yum -y install git 安装结束!

17410
  • linux 环境下安装使用 git

    linux安装git 安装命令 $ sudo apt-get install git 配置用户和邮箱 $ git config --global user.name \"Han XiaoTong\"...: git init git add README clone仓库 克隆仓库的命令格式为 git clone [url] 在当前目录下克隆项目,目录为grit $ git clone git://...github.com/schacon/grit.git 在当前目录下克隆项目,目录为mygrit $ git clone git://github.com/schacon/grit.git mygrit...将文件纳入git管理 查看仓库内文档的状态,显示跟踪文件列表 $ git status 将文件纳入git管理 $ git add 指定项目下某些文件不纳入git管理 # 此为注释...rm grit.gemspec 从git仓库(即暂存区)删除,但保留本地文件 $ git rm --cached readme.txt 删除log目录下所有的.log结尾的文件 $ git rm

    3.7K20

    Git客户端安装及使用

    背景 为了我帅气而高大尚的博客一直在研究github,在网上找了一圈,找到了Git的客户端 安装github Git是目前世界上最先进的分布式版本控制系统,git与svn的五个基本区别。...下载git客户端 下载之后,安装git ? ? 选择安装路径,千万不要选带中文的路径,否则会引起不必要的误会 ?...设置环境变量 : 选择使用什么样的命令行工具, 一般情况下我们默认使用Git Bash即可, 默认选择; 1.Git自带 : 使用Git自带的Git Bash命令行工具; 2.系统自带CMD : 使用Windows...选择终端模拟器,依然默认就好 1.使用MinTTY,就是在Windows开了一个简单模拟Linux命令环境的窗口Git Bash 2.使用windows的系统的命令行程序cmd.exe ?...绑定用户 找到安装的git的包,打开git-bash.exe 因为Git是分布式版本控制系统,所以需要填写用户名和邮箱作为一个标识,用户和邮箱为你github注册的账号和邮箱 ?

    2.1K80

    Git客户端下载及安装

    Git客户端下载 截止博客发布的时间,Git最新版本是2.10.2。...我们可以从官网下载,官网下载链接如下: 点击打开官网下载链接 如果觉得官网下载太慢,也可以从如下CSDN的链接下载: 点击打开CSDN下载链接 Git客户端安装过程 1.双击安装程序“Git-2.10.2...5.点击“Next”,显示截图如下: 设置环境变量 选择使用什么样的命令行工具,一般情况下我们默认使用Git Bash即可: (1)Git自带:使用Git自带的Git Bash命令行工具。...7.选择之后,点击“Next”,显示截图如下: 8.选择之后,点击“Next”,显示截图如下: 9.选择之后,点击“Install”,开始安装,截图显示如下: 10.安装完成之后,显示截图如下:...这样,我们的Git客户端就下载并安装完成了。

    1.7K10

    【Git】Linux系统下Git的升级

    Git 在很多发行版的 Linux 系统里的版本都很低,比如说比 2.18 这个版本还低,这里比较的一般就是码农的本地环境,因为本地 Mac 系统等等大家经常用到的预装的 Git 的版本都比较深,Git...的版本太低有很多衍生问题,除了本身 Git 的各种命令的区别以外,另外就是 Go 编译的时候会遇到一些问题,因为 go get 底层封装的其实就是 Git 的各种命令,比如 git fetch 什么之类的...,有冲突那就看哪里有冲突就是了,比如下面这个命令,就不能一下子帮我都把软件装好了,后面还是得反反复复。...最后,等我把包都装好了,再执行一次 make install install-doc install-html install-info 的命令,最后安装结束后就没有再报错了。 ?...git version 检查一下,搞定。 ?

    2.2K30

    linux下安装opencv_linux下安装pycharm

    SELINUX=disabled/g" /etc/selinux/config 一、RabbitMQ介绍 RabbitMQ是一个开源的AMQP实现,服务器端用Erlang语言编写,支持多种客户端...二、下载RabbitMQ所需要的安装包,即Erlang 和 RabbitMQ 1、RabbitMQ是Erlang语言编写的,所以在安装RabbitMQ之前,需要先安装Erlang。...,进入到Linux版的RabbitMQ下载页面中 7、找到Download下的 rabbitmq-server-generic-unix-3.7.16.tar.xz下载链接并点击,开始进行下载RabbitMQ...三、把下载好的RabbitMQ 和 Erlang上传到Linux服务器上 1、打开WinSCP,把我们下载好的RabbitMQ 和 Erlang安装包,上传到Linux的 /mnt/ 文件目录下...2、使用putty连接到我们的Linux服务器,进入到/mnt/ 文件目录中,并解压上传的RabbitMQ 和 Erlang安装包 [root@localhost ~]# cd /mnt/ //

    24.8K10

    Git编译安装教程Linux安装Git最新版

    文章时间:2020年2月22日 23:43:39 解决问题:Git编译安装 系统版本:Cent os 7.x 第一步 安装相关依赖 第二步 下载git源码 第三步 解压进入文件夹 第四步 配置...git安装路径 第五步 编译并且安装 第六步 将git指令添加到bash中 第七步 生效配置并查看版本 第一步 安装相关依赖 直接复制下面命令,然后运行即可。.../scm/git/ 第三步 解压进入文件夹 tar -zxvf git-2.24.0.tar.gz cd git-2.24.0 第四步 配置git安装路径 直接复制命令运行即可。.../configure prefix=/usr/local/git/ 第五步 编译并且安装 直接复制命令运行即可。...export PATH=$PATH:/usr/local/git/bin 第七步 生效配置并查看版本 source /etc/profile 查看git版本号 git --version

    8K21

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券